RIAM Junior & Transition Strings 

The RIAM Junior String Group was founded by Sheila O’Grady in 1994 with the important purpose of training young string players in the art of ensemble string playing.   

A burgeoning number of young string enthusiasts at the Academy necessitated the development of two separate ensembles in 2014: RIAM Junior Strings and RIAM Transition Strings directed by violinist Yvonne Donnelly and cellist Yue Tang respectively.   

Junior Strings is a fun, preparatory group which gently introduces young players to the joy of orchestral string playing, whilst Transition Strings aims to nurture and challenge the Academy’s more seasoned young players by extending the orchestral playing experience.   

These busy and vibrant young musicians perform annually at the RIAM Performing Groups concerts in venues including the National Concert Hall, O’Reilly Theatre, Belvedere College and St Andrew’s Church, Westland Row.  Past seasons have also seen them perform at the National Gallery of Ireland, and Watergate Theatre, Kilkenny.  These exciting young musicians have also performed in aid of a number of charities and recorded a CD Children for Children in aid of Barnardos.
